Avoiding Common AR Reconciliation Mistakes

Data entry errors often happen when payroll teams split focus between invoicing and compensation. Implement a strict double-check process.

Checklist for Weekly Revenue Reconciliation

  • Compare bank deposits to issued invoice logs.
  • Verify client names against current service contracts.
  • Flag any unpaid invoices past the 30-day mark.
  • Document communication attempts with late-paying accounts.
